The Bribery Act and Promotional Goods
A Guide to what is allowed under the new law
What’s Happened?
• The Bribery Act updates existing laws from 1889
• The new UK Bribery Act 2010 prohibits bribery, or attempted bribery and is effective from July 1st 2011
What Can You Do?
Take clients to corporate events such as Wimbledon and the Grand Prix
Provide customers with branded garments, such as polo shirts, fleeces
Give promotional items such as branded folders
Take clients to dinner
What Can’t You Do?
× Pay business kickbacks
× Provide corrupt secret commissions
× Make payments made to obtain a
business advantage (also known as
‘the brown envelope’)
What Are The Penalties?
• Individuals can face up to 10 years in prison
• And an unlimited fine
• Companies can also face unlimited fines
